Youth

  
Our programming for Middle School and Senior High youth on Sunday mornings and Friday  or Saturday nights builds on the foundation laid in our children’s ministries. Using small group interaction and larger group activities, our staff seeks to exalt Jesus Christ. through training the young people and providing a godly example. Students in 5th-8th grade face the tough transitional times as they move from elementary to middle school, and as they physically go from being a child to becoming a young adult. The staff understands those difficulties and uses regular programs and special activities to help them make those transitions from a godly and biblical foundation.  The JYC (6th to 9th grades) meet every other Friday night during the school year.  Special outings including bowling, concerts, and ministry are scheduled throughout the year.
 
High school students, in the 9th to 12th grades receive ongoing training to develop a biblical worldview, while discussing the current events and interests this generation faces. Designed to stimulate a deeper love for God’s Word and an understanding of absolute truth in the midst of a culture of ever-changing values, our youth ministries on Sunday mornings and every other Saturday evening want our young people to understand how to be in the world, but not of it.
